No fim de semana passada decorreu mais uma edição fantástica do Goodwood Festival of Speed, um evento que dispensa apresentações, estando muito bem integrado no seio do mundo automóvel como um dos melhores eventos que existem, uma vez que junta os melhores exemplares de automóveis e motos da história, assim como personalidades de renome. Este ano a marca central do evento foi a MG e a sua celebração do 100º aniversário.
No campo da disciplina rainha do desporto motorizado, a Fórmula 1, a Red Bull levou até ao evento uma série de automóveis do passado e presente, assim como os seus pilotos Max Verstappen e Sérgio Perez. Além desta marcaram também presença as equipas da Alpine, Ferrari, McLaren, Mercedes-AMG e Williams. Para finalizar o campo da Fórmula 1, há ainda a destacar a piloto Lia Block que conduziu um Fórmula 1 pela primeira vez em público.
Michael Dunlop, piloto lendário da Isle of Man TT também marcou presença, assim como John McGuinness e Peter Hickman. Outra lenda do desporto motorizado que também marcou presença, mas desta vez ligado ao NASCAR, é Richard Petty, que venceu o campeonato por sete vezes, juntando-se ao seu Plymouth Superbird com que competiu em 1970 e que fez a subida pelas mãos do seu filho Kyle. Obviamente que muitos outros pilotos marcaram presença, mas iriamos estar em encher o artigo com nomes. Ainda assim podemos destacar Mick Doohan, Elfyn Evans, Damon Hill, Jacky Ickx, Sebastian Ogier, Emanuele Pirro, Kalle Rovenperä, Carlos Sainz e Kevin Schwantz.
Não poderíamos terminar sem destacar os automóveis que foram apresentados na edição deste ano do Goodwood Festival of Speed, como a Ford Raptor T1 que irá competir no próximo Rally Dakar, o renovado Porsche 911, o Land Rover Defender Octa, Pagani Huayra Epitome, o BMW M5 e a cereja no topo do bolo o Red Bull RB17.
